Al Shamsi has been developing his educational philosophy in publications for more than a decade , passionately promoting the need to revamp education – to rethink it in the light of present-day realities and emerging technologies like IoT and robotics . “ We are fed up with the traditional ways of delivering instruction . For the present generation the traditional model of classroom teaching has become boring , and it creates the attitude of ' I just want to get my degree and get out of here : after that , I ' ll think about what work I ' m going to do !’ I was drawing attention to the implications of the fourth industrial revolution before that term became current , and I am proud of that and the interest it has attracted .”
He has led the growth of HCT for six years now , and is pleased with the steep rate of progress to date , while anticipating further huge changes in the coming five years . “ With 16 separate campuses and 23,000 students ,

we have a secure place on the global academic scene , but we are more concerned with the applied nature of our programme : to prepare our youth to serve and to be the number one choice for employers in different industry and business sectors . We maintain the academic rigour of our courses to the highest international level while always keeping a clear eye on real-world relevance . We think we have a different educational blend , one that is more demanding .”
